Popularity of Drama & Theater Arts at Appalachian State University

In the most recent year for which we have data, Appalachian State University awarded 28 bachelor’s degrees in drama & theater arts.

How Much Student Debt Do Drama & Theater Arts Graduates from Appalachian State University Have?

$24,755 Bachelor's Median Debt

Student Debt of Drama & Theater Arts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

Earning a bachelor’s degree at Appalachian State University, drama & theater arts students accumulate a median of $24,755 in student loans. This is above $22,075, the typical median for all majors at Appalachian State University.

Appalachian State University Drama & Theater Arts Bachelor’s Program Diversity

For the most recent academic year available, 36% of drama & theater arts bachelor’s degrees went to men and 64% went to women.

Appalachian State University gender breakdown of Drama & Theater Arts Bachelor's degree grads

The largest share of drama & theater arts bachelor’s degree graduates at Appalachian State University are White. Roughly 82% of graduates fell into this category.
